How much does it cost to rent a home in Fayetteville?
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
---|---|---|---|
Fayetteville 2 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$1,137 | $850 | $1,295 |
Fayetteville 3 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$1,651 | $1,295 | $2,100 |
Fayetteville 4 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$2,016 | $1,645 | $2,695 |
Fayetteville 5 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$3,400 | $3,400 | $3,400 |

Frequently Asked Questions about Fayetteville
What type of rentals are currently available in Fayetteville?
There are currently 54 Apartments for Rent in Fayetteville, TN with pricing that ranges from $655 to $2,950. There are also 44 Single Family Homes for rent, Condos, and Townhome rentals currently available in Fayetteville ranging from $850 to $3,400.
What is the current price range for Rental Homes in Fayetteville?
Today's rental pricing for Homes for Rent, Condos and Townhomes in Fayetteville ranges from $850 to $3,400 with an average monthly rent of $1,880.
How much are larger Three and Four Bedroom Rentals in Fayetteville?
For those who are looking for larger living arrangements, Three Bedroom Apartments in Fayetteville range from $770 to $2,814, while Three Bedroom Homes, Condos, and Townhomes for rent range from $1,295 to $2,100. Four Bedroom Single-Family rentals are also available starting from $1,645 and Four Bedroom Apartments start at $1,500.
